  • This is the "Vandal" project. It's a 2001 Chevrolet 1500 Truck that I'm cleaning up to be my new daily driver. After my move back home to San Antonio, I noticed that traffic was much busier. To avoid wrecking my Blue truck or getting it stolen, I decided to retire it to "Toy" status and get a cheap work truck.
    Specs:
    2001 half ton with 130k miles
    4.8L Engine
    4L60e Trans
    3.42 Rear gear (currently open diff)

    • @AGearHead4Life
      @AGearHead4Life  7 років тому

      The power steering pulley upgrade is not a huge issue. I'm doing it because it looks much better. Also, if you ever need to remove the PS pump, you can do it without having to remove the pulley, like with the factory pulley. With the newer truck pulley, you can put your tool right through the pulley to remove the PS pump bolts.
